Goal setting is the process of developing ways to help you focus on achieving your goal. S.M.A.R.T. Goal setting uses the strategy published by George T. Doran to provide effective guidance in developing goals that have a clear direction, purpose, and timely. S.M.A.R.T. stands for SPECIFIC, MEASURABLE, ATTAINABLE, RELEVANT, and TIME-BOUND. Teaching Procedures and Routines in the elementary classroom is the most effective method of classroom management. Classroom procedures and routines are the systematic ways that you and your students repeatedly complete daily, weekly, or monthly tasks. Having these is how the classroom runs efficiently and effectively.
